How does humanity fit into nature? How long have we viewed ourselves as being apart from it? And what are the problems that creates?

This time, we chat with Tom Oliver and Marzia Briel from the University of Reading to learn about their Nature-centric Catalyst project. We discuss the rights of nature, the advocacy landscape today, and how we can better centre the natural world in our thoughts and deeds.

Also, we end with a 5-minute meditation, beautifully performed by Marzia.
